TTTM Healthcare are currently recruiting an Assistant Director of Nursing on behalf of a Kilkenny based acute Hospital.
Job type: Permanent / Full-Time
Sector and subsector: Medical & Healthcare | Management / Senior Appointments
Qualifications & Experience
Essential:
Registered General Nurse with the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Ireland (NMBI), or eligible to register.
5-7 years post-registration experience in the acute hospital setting within the last 9 years.
Demonstrate 2 years management experience at CNM 111 level.
Completed a formal recognised post-registration relevant to the role (eg. Management)
Demonstrate understanding of, and commitment to, the underpinning requirements and key processes in providing quality patient centred care.
Demonstrate leadership skills and ability to influence others.
Demonstrate knowledge and experience of quality audit/assurance systems.
Strong knowledge of financial and budgetary controls.
Experience with clinical and professional practice development.
Strong IT/Applications skills.
Experience as a standard lead with JCI.
Desirable:
Relevant Masters
